Solvent-free rubber rollers are high-speed rubber rollers. The balance of rubber rollers is a key factor in design and manufacturing, and it is also a necessary way to ensure the quality and performance of rubber rollers. Why do solvent-free compound rubber rollers need to be balanced? This column is explained in detail.
1. The purpose of balance
The process of rubber roller balancing is to change the distribution of roller mass so that its center of gravity is consistent with the axis of the supporting bearing. The purpose of balancing is to reduce vibration.
An unbalance occurs when the center of gravity of a rubber roller deviates from the rotation axis defined by the bearings at both ends. If the unbalance of the rubber roller is not properly treated, excessive vibration will occur. And when the speed increases, the vibration will also increase.
Vibration is an important issue for high-speed compound machines. Excessive amount of vibration will lead to a reduction in compound quality and obstacles to the normal operation of the machine itself. Excessive vibration may cause the following problems:
(1) Reduce the mechanical efficiency of the machine.
(2) Uneven pressure caused by uneven pressure, resulting in unevenness of coating compound.
(3) Increase the wear of roller bearings.
(4) Affect the stability of the substrate tension.
(5) Limit or reduce the mechanical speed.
(6) Increase the wrinkle of the substrate.
(7) Increase the overheating or delamination of the adhesive layer.
2. Balance reasons and treatment methods
The unfavorable condition corresponding to balance is unbalance, including static unbalance and dynamic unbalance.
1) The cause of static imbalance and its treatment
Common causes of static imbalance are:
(1) Defects or irregularities in the iron core.
(2) Poor processing.
(3) The inside of the iron core tube is eccentric.
(4) Defects in encapsulation or other problems.
Static balance is achieved by placing (or removing) a weight on a section (also called a correction surface) perpendicular to the rubber roller's vertical axis of rotation to ensure that the unbalance of the rubber roller is within the specified range when it is stationary.
2) Reasons for dynamic imbalance and their treatment
Dynamic balance is the balance of the rubber roller during rotation. Statically balanced rubber rollers are not necessarily dynamically balanced. The roller shaft must perform both static and dynamic balancing. When the rotation speed and the length-to-diameter ratio increase to a certain value, balance becomes a critical issue.
The cause of dynamic imbalance may be the same as static imbalance, but it may also be related to other factors, such as shape, such as poor cylindricity. Doing dynamic balance can solve the problems of static unbalance and dynamic unbalance.
The iron core must first be balanced by its processing plant. Balance review should also be carried out when re-encapsulating. After the rubber roller is covered with rubber, dynamic balance testing is also required.
Dynamic balancing is achieved by placing counterweights on two or more sections of the vertical and rotating shafts of the rubber roller. Perform correction balance on two or more sections (also called correction planes) of the rubber roller at the same time to remove the remaining unbalanced amount to ensure that the unbalanced amount of the rubber roller is within the specified range when rotating. Dynamic balance is often called double-sided balance, and static balance is also called single-sided balance.
The perfect balance can only be achieved in theory, even if the cost can be achieved, it may not be acceptable. Therefore, an acceptable balance is usually determined. The following factors need to be considered:
(1) The running speed of the machine.
(2) The structural rigidity of the rubber roller itself.
(3) Use conditions of rubber rollers.
(4) The rigidity of the support.
